Paste Seeks TV Section Editor

Paste Magazine is hiring a new TV editor to oversee all the written content in our TV section. The TV editor’s job is to assign stories to and edit our team of staff and freelance TV writers and our assistant TV editor. Other responsibilities include writing for the site; conducting interviews and discussing television shows and trends for our podcasts and video channels; and organizing guides to the best shows on various streaming services.

Candidate must have at least four years of experience writing about television or editing written TV content. Pay is commensurate to experience. The job is based in our headquarters in Atlanta, though secondary consideration will be given to candidates located in New York to work out of our Manhattan office.
